全球视野下的MySQL云数据库:海外服务深度解析与选型指南
2025.09.26 21:39浏览量:1简介:本文深度剖析海外主流MySQL云数据库服务,从技术架构、性能优化、安全合规到成本模型,为开发者与企业提供选型决策的完整方法论。
一、海外MySQL云数据库的核心技术架构
海外云服务商的MySQL云数据库普遍采用分布式架构与自动化管理技术,以AWS Aurora、Google Cloud SQL、Azure Database for MySQL为例,其技术实现存在显著差异:
- 存储计算分离架构
AWS Aurora通过将存储层下沉至共享存储池,实现计算节点故障时的秒级切换。例如,当主节点宕机时,系统可在60秒内从共享存储恢复数据并启动新实例,这种设计使可用性达到99.99%。 - 智能缓存与查询优化
Google Cloud SQL的查询缓存机制采用LRU-K算法,结合机器学习预测热点数据。实测显示,在OLTP场景下,重复查询响应时间可降低72%。 - 自动化扩展策略
Azure Database for MySQL的弹性扩展功能支持按秒计费,用户可通过API动态调整vCore数量。例如,电商大促期间,系统可在5分钟内将计算资源从4核扩展至32核,应对突发流量。
二、性能优化与监控实践
海外云数据库的性能调优工具链已形成完整生态:
- 慢查询分析与索引优化
AWS RDS Performance Insights提供可视化查询执行计划,可自动识别未使用索引的查询。例如,某金融系统通过该工具发现customer_transactions表的transaction_date字段缺少索引,优化后查询耗时从2.3秒降至0.15秒。 - 连接池管理策略
Google Cloud SQL的连接池配置建议:-- 优化前(高并发下连接超时)SET GLOBAL max_connections = 500;-- 优化后(使用ProxySQL中间件)[proxysql]max_connections=2000pool_mode=session
- 参数调优经验
Azure数据库团队推荐的InnoDB缓冲池配置公式:innodb_buffer_pool_size = (物理内存 * 0.7) - 系统保留内存
在32GB内存的实例中,建议设置为21GB,可减少90%的磁盘I/O。
三、安全合规与数据主权
跨国企业需重点关注以下合规要求:
- GDPR数据本地化
欧盟企业要求数据存储在境内数据中心。AWS在法兰克福、巴黎等地的Region提供MySQL服务,通过数据加密传输(TLS 1.3)和静态加密(AES-256)满足合规需求。 - 跨境数据传输认证
使用AWS DMS(Database Migration Service)进行跨国迁移时,需完成SCCP(Standard Contractual Clauses)认证。某制造业客户通过该方案将中国区数据迁移至美国Region,耗时缩短60%。 - 审计日志与访问控制
Google Cloud SQL的Cloud Audit Logs可记录所有管理操作,结合IAM角色权限管理,实现最小权限原则。例如,开发人员仅授予cloudsql.instances.get权限,而非管理员权限。
四、成本优化模型与ROI分析
海外云数据库的成本构成复杂,需建立量化评估体系:
- 预留实例与按需实例组合
AWS RDS的3年预留实例可节省65%成本。某SaaS企业采用混合模式:
- 基础负载:70%资源使用3年预留实例
- 峰值负载:30%资源使用按需实例
年度成本降低42%。
- 存储类型选择
Google Cloud SQL提供三种存储选项:
| 类型 | IOPS范围 | 成本系数 | 适用场景 |
|——————|—————-|—————|————————————|
| 标准SSD | 100-10k | 1.0x | 开发测试环境 |
| 平衡SSD | 10k-30k | 1.5x | 常规生产环境 |
| 内存优化SSD| 30k-100k | 2.5x | 高并发交易系统 | - 跨Region复制成本
Azure的Geo-Replication功能在主从Region间同步数据时,会产生额外的网络出口费用。建议将同步频率设置为5分钟一次,而非实时同步,可降低30%成本。
五、选型决策框架与实施路径
企业需建立多维评估模型:
- 技术适配性矩阵
| 评估维度 | AWS Aurora | Google Cloud SQL | Azure MySQL |
|————————|——————|—————————|——————-|
| 兼容性 | MySQL 5.7+ | MySQL 8.0 | MySQL 5.6+ |
| 自动化备份 | 支持 | 支持 | 支持 |
| 跨Region复制 | 6个Region | 4个Region | 3个Region | - 迁移实施路线图
以传统MySQL到AWS Aurora的迁移为例:
- 阶段1:使用AWS Schema Conversion Tool评估兼容性
- 阶段2:通过AWS DMS进行数据同步(全量+增量)
- 阶段3:在蓝绿环境中验证应用功能
- 阶段4:切换DNS至新端点
某银行客户通过该方案实现零停机迁移,业务中断时间<30秒。
六、未来趋势与技术演进
海外云数据库正在向智能化方向发展:
- AI驱动的自动调优
Google Cloud SQL的AI优化器可自动调整innodb_flush_neighbors等200+参数,实测使TPS提升18%。 - Serverless形态进化
AWS Aurora Serverless v2支持毫秒级扩展,在电商促销场景中,可自动从2个ACU扩展至128个ACU,应对10倍流量突增。 - 多云管理平台
MongoDB Atlas等第三方服务提供跨云管理能力,支持同时使用AWS、GCP、Azure的MySQL服务,降低供应商锁定风险。
结语:海外MySQL云数据库已形成技术、安全、成本的完整竞争体系。企业需结合业务场景,建立包含技术适配度、合规风险、TCO模型的决策框架。建议从试点项目入手,逐步构建多云架构,在保障数据主权的同时,获取全球资源优势。

发表评论
登录后可评论,请前往 登录 或 注册